Who was Hans Wilhelm Frei?

Hans Wilhelm Frei was a biblical scholar and theologian who is best known for work on biblical hermeneutics. Frei's work played a major role in the development of postliberal theology. His best-known and most influential work is his 1974 book, The Eclipse of Biblical Narrative, which examined the history of eighteenth- and nineteenth century biblical hermeneutics in England and Germany. Frei spent much of his career teaching at Yale Divinity School.
